In the landscape of electrical engineering education, the transition from understanding discrete components to designing complex integrated circuits (ICs) is a formidable challenge. For decades, the textbook by Roger T. Howe and Charles G. Sodini has served as a critical bridge. While many texts focus strictly on circuit analysis or device physics, this work is distinguished by its holistic methodology, linking the physical implementation of a device with its circuit-level behavior.
